The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) collects the data necessary to determine a student's eligibility for participation in the following federal student assistance programs identified in the Higher Education Act (HEA): the Federal Pell Grant Program; the Campus-Based Programs; the William D. Ford Federal Direct Loan Program; the Federal Family Education Program; the Academic Competitiveness Grant; and the National Science and Mathematics Access to Retain Talent (SMART) Grant.

PL: Pub.L. 89 - 329 401-495 Name of Law: Higher Education Act of 1965, as amended

The total net FAFSA burden hours will increase by 286,400 hours. This results from an adjustment of 636,995 hours and program change decrease of 350,595. The adjustment results from a projected 3 percent increase in the total number of FAFSA submissions during the 2009-2010 FAFSA processing cycle. This growth is due to the weakening national economy (individuals historically return to school during economic downturns) and a growth in the college age population in the U.S. from the previous year. The program change reduction results from the removal of the FAFSA4caster tool as an IC from last year's submission.
